STEP
ONE: Remove step plate and panel
1) Remove the plastic door step plate by carefully
pulling it up by hand.
2) Remove the plastic panel that is adjacent to the
door and under the dash.
3) Expose the wires that are behind the panel and
find the black wire that has the blue stripe.
STEP
TWO:
Run wire from boards into vehicle.
1) Run the wire from under the running board up behind
the door hinge and through the rubber housing for
the speaker wires. FIG A
2) Pull the wire inside the vehicle so there is no
excess hanging in the door or under the running board.
The plastic covering may be removed on the wires that
are inside the vehicle.
STEP
THREE: Attach Ground wires.
Fig B
1) Find a suitable place to attach the ground wires.
There are bolts screwed into the wall of the vehicle
on both sides.
2) Expose 1" of the ground wires (black).
3) Loosen a bolt and wrap the black wire around it,
then re-tighten.
4) Repeat the process on the opposite side.
STEP FOUR: Attach positive
wires.
Fig C
1) Cut through the black wire with the blue stripe
on the passenger side. The dome light should go out
at this point.
2) Run the positive wire from the driver's side under
the dash to come out on the passenger side.
3) Splice the positive (red) wires from both the driver
and passenger sides into the black wire with the blue
stripe.
4) Tape any exposed wires and check that both the
dome light and running board lights operate correctly
when the door is open.
STEP
FIVE: Replace Panels
1) Snap the side panels back on.
2) Snap the door kick plates back on.
